ComedyCity hosts 26.2 hour marathon

By: Jennifer Schneider
Updated: March 15, 2013
watch video

DE PERE, Wis. (WFRV) - ComedyCity in De Pere is once again hosting its 26.2 hour comedy marathon.

The show is tonight and tomorrow. The proceeds raise money for two local children's cancer charities.

Local 5's Kris Schuller got a lesson on improv today from Gary Radke, the co-coordinator of the event.
